One of the core practices involves obtaining prior express consent from recipients before initiating any outbound calls or texts. This means that sales representatives must have a clear, documented permission from prospects to contact them, whether through a signed form, an email confirmation, or an interactive opt-in on a website. For instance, simply relying on a customer’s purchase history or generic sign-ups isn’t enough; the onus is on companies to ensure explicit consent.
